Martin Stopford (* 1947 in Bolton ) is a British economist and managing director of the maritime services company Clarksons .

Education and professional career

Stopford completed his schooling in Shrewsbury and Staffordshire and later studied politics, philosophy and economics in Oxford and London. After completing his studies, he received a doctorate in economics in 1979 . He worked as early as the early 1970s on the publication of maritime studies and from 1977 for the state shipbuilding company British Shipbuilders Corporation . After a two-year stint at Chase Manhattan Bank , Stopford joined Clarkson Research in 1990 and moved up to its board of directors in 2004.

Martin Stopford teaches as a regular lecturer and course leader at the Cambridge Academy of Transport and as a visiting professor at Cass Business School , Dalian Maritime University , Copenhagen Business School and Newcastle University .

In addition to numerous publications and lectures, Stopford is best known for the publication of the work Maritime Economics . The book, which has been published in three editions since 1988, is one of the standard works of the maritime economy. In 2005, Stopford was awarded the Chojeong Book Prize for Maritime Economics . The Southampton Solent University awarded Stopford 2009 an honorary doctorate and the journal Lloyd's List honored him in 2010 with an award for his life's work. In 2015, Stopford received the Onassis Prize .

Private

Martin Stopford has two children, Ben and Elizabeth. He runs organic farming on his farm in the Staffordshire Moorlands.
